I wonder if you realize that build on metabattle change with every balance patch. This patch is nothing out of the ordinary and won't bother metabattle any more than every other patch. Fact is that a relic granting stab on healing skill use is something useful to many professions in a player vs player setting.

The old centaur runeset 6th bonus is gone? Metabattle will adapt and even forget easily. That's how it has always been and how it will continue to be. Just let it go and go with the flow, it will be easier on you than overthinking uselessly about what you've lost.

If any group or individual lack swiftness there are plenty of options to get it in a different way than taking centaur runes or relic specifically. Comparatively, stab is pretty rare. And if you're still not convinced, know that revenant just need jalis and a blast finisher to get perma swiftness. Ventari with salvation traited work as well. Herald can vomit swiftness as well. Rapid flow in invocation also work, renegade have it's own source... etc. If your still not happy, there are sigils for that and even food that provide swiftness.

So, with all of this I can garantee you, "metabattle" don't care whether or not the 6th bonus aoe swiftness on rune of the centaur still exist or not. If anything, metabattle is happy to see that now there is an option to get stability as stability is, comparatively, a rare and valuable boon.
